The Camera Guard is built well and seems like it'll add some protection if landing onto something. I haven't had the opportunity to confirm that though. There are a lot of similar guards, but some are made of plastic and/or do not appear to be made as well.
For gimbal protectors, I've tried the Inertia Guard and Phantom Fix (the original version). You definitely should not buy the original Phantom fix -- since it is semi-permanently attached with double sided tape and is hand made. The Phantom Fix 2 screws on and is machined, so it has a more precise fit. If cost is important, I'd recommend the Phantom Fix 2. If you're looking for the most polished product, then I'd recommend the Gimbal Saver. Both should offer the same amount of protection since the designs are nearly identical.
